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ly San Jacinto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ly San Jacinto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in San Jacinto is $1,636.

What is the largest Pet Friendly San Jacinto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in San Jacinto is a 1,134 square feet unit starting from $1,215 at Amberwood Villas.

What is the average size for San Jacinto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in San Jacinto is currently at 532 sq ft.
